Teslagrad developer Rain Games has almost finished up its new game World to the West. Today, it was announced that the game is coming to Wii U as originally promised on May 5. It’ll cost $29.99 / €29.99. English, German, French, Spanish, Italian, Norwegian, Chinese, Dutch, Arab and Polish are all supported.

Here’s an overview:

“World to the West is a standalone followup of Teslagrad, the indie hit that conquered the hearts of many puzzle-lovers three years ago. A 3D action adventure with a cartoony art style, inspired by those light-hearted RPGs from our past that made us face the challenges with a smile. A vast world of blue skies and dark caves awaits you, as you try to unveil the mysteries of an ancient prophecy. You’ll join four characters in this journey: Lumina the Teslamancer, Knaus the underdog, Miss Teri the treasure hunter and the gloriously mustachioed strongman, Lord Clonington, each one with their own storyline and abilities.”

And a trailer:

World to the West will be at EGX Rezzed, London, between March 30 and April 1.

Tomorrow is MAR10 Day, and Nintendo is celebrating the event in various ways.

First, Nintendo is teaming up with Starlight Children’s Foundation. Here’s what you can expect from that:

“To kick off the celebration, Nintendo is working with Starlight Children’s Foundation, a nonprofit organization that brightens the lives of seriously ill children by providing hospitalized kids with entertainment, education and innovative technology. Nintendo will be providing new designs for the foundation’s Starlight Brave Gowns, which help sick kids feel like superstars by replacing unattractive, uncomfortable and embarrassing hospital garments with comfortable and brightly colored gowns. Featuring characters from the Mushroom Kingdom, these new Starlight Brave Gowns include colorful depictions of Mario, Luigi, Princess Peach, Donkey Kong and Yoshi. Additionally, Nintendo will provide a donation to Starlight Children’s Foundation to help create 2,000 gowns for this fun and colorful program.”

According to a new report from Vandal, Switch is now Spain’s best console launch ever. The PlayStation 4 was the previous record holder, but the torch has been passed to Nintendo’s system having sold 45,000 units in its first three days.

Switch seems to have sold through almost its entire batch of stock in Spain. Roughly 50,000 units were shipped to the country, resulting in a very high sell-through rate. More units should be making their way to out Spain in the weeks ahead.

In making The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ild, director Hidemaro Fujibayashi tells The New Yorker that the team had total freedom. He told the publication about how Nintendo approached development:

“They said, ‘Change anything you want.’ So we wrote down all of the stress points, the things that make Zelda games less enjoyable, and we replaced them with new ideas.”

The New Yorker also spoke with technical director Takuhiro Dohta about Breath of the Wild’s chemistry engine. This is built on top of the physics engine, and allows for all sorts of antics like cooking, fire spreading on grass, and much more.

Putting it together wasn’t easy though. “At many times in the process, there were things that just weren’t functioning at all,” Dohta said. “We’d have to remove everything and build back up again.”
